The Merck Animal Health Diversity Applicant Fee Assistance Program, administered by Association of American Veterinary Medical Colleges (AAVMC), will provide a limited number of fee waivers to qualified applicants to have one additional designation fee waived. Qualified applicants include those who are from groups that are underrepresented in veterinary medicine (URVM), first-generation college students, and Pell Grant eligible students.


You may be eligible for a secondary application fee waiver. A very limited number of fee waivers are available through this program and the deadline for requesting a fee waiver is August 14, 2025 or once the allotted funds are exhausted. Please wait to request a fee waiver until you are prepared to submit your application as the fee waivers will have an expiration of 14 days from the date of approval.


Your request for a waiver must be received before you submit your VMCAS application. If granted, you will receive a waiver equivalent to one "secondary school" fee ($132).


If you apply to more VMCAS schools, you are responsible for an incremental fee of $132 for each additional designation. This fee assistance program is applied to the VMCAS application fee only. You are still responsible for any supplemental application fees.
